Abstract

Data inputs are described in these sections; first the global gravity field model EIGEN 6C4 (and the role of the gradiometry data from GOCE in it), then the bed topography under the ice cover in the Bedmap 2 model, and then their combination in the spherical harmonic expansion SatGravRET14 (the actually used model to compute the gravity aspects in this Atlas). We note about the polar gap in the data, data resolution, and about other data sources. Finally we provide a practical guide to the figures in this Atlas.
